“Development and validation of a device to detect Salmonella nucleases in food”.
Collaborative project:
Objective: Development of a rapid analysis system for Salmonella spp., in food matrices.
Advantage of this new analysis system:
– Speed (<8h)
– Simplicity (avoiding laborious processes)
– Reduced cost (compared to existing offer)
– Possibility to be used in portable and/or disposable format
The new device is based on the use of nucleic acid probes specific to nucleases produced by Salmonella that were already successfully selected and validated in a previous project.
